This bow cake was made for a friend's 22nd birthday. The cake inside is s butter cake recipe (Duncan Hines and it tasted really yummy). Its iced with a crusting buttercream recipe (then I dyed a soft pink). I then used the paper towel method (Google it) to smooth out my edges (icing a cake properly is like the hardest thing for me).

I then used the same color frosting to pipe some swirly designs on the cake with a plain circle tip. It great to add a little texture to the cake since its the same color and it also makes your imperfections blend in).

I then made my bow. I rolled my embosser over the edges to create a "fabric seam". I stuffed the bow loops with paper towel while they dried. The ribbon edges hanging out the cake were placed on the side to dry and positioned so that they would flow I guess you can call it.

After all was dry (overnight is best but I was in a rush so it was more like a couple of hours) and set, I adhered the bow with some royal icing and dusted it with pink luster dust. It was prettier in person, in the photo it just looks sweaty.
